Lois: How does a guy with 9 phones not return a phone call? Clark: Oliver's probably celebrating with someone else. Lois: Wow. Tall, dark, and single. (I've always thought that dark stands for someone with black hair but Oliver is blond? Is my assumption correct?) Go figure.

"Tall, dark, and handsome" is a collocation - it's a cliche used to describe a desirable man. She's making a play on that. It's been in use so long I don't think anybody even thinks about the literal meaning of the "dark" part, but I suppose it could be taken to mean "mysterious."
